Internal Memo — Joint Venture Proposal

For the incoming director. Crestbourne Analytics has received a joint venture proposal from Veylan Systems covering sensor manufacturing in the Ardmouth corridor. Terms: 55/45 equity split in our favour, shared IP on the Lattice controller platform, five-year initial term. Diligence flags: Veylan's capacity claims unverified; exit clauses thin. Legal review due in two weeks. Recommendation from the strategy group is conditional support. The board's confidential position on this venture is stated below.

internal memo for hahif-hahaf: Headcount on the Zorwyn team goes from 9 to 100 by the end of October. Gross margin on Zorwyn came in at 5 percent against a plan of 10 percent.

Handover Note — Director Transition, Operations

To all heads of department: as I pass responsibilities to my successor, the open item is the Fernhollow plant capacity decision. We must choose between adding a third shift or commissioning the mothballed Line B by quarter-end. Cost models from engineering favour Line B; HR flags staffing risk either way. My successor will chair the decision meeting. The confidential recommendation going to the board is set out below.

board note of fahif-yahog: Gross margin on Wenath came in at 10 percent against a plan of 5 percent. Only 3 of the 100 pilot accounts renewed Wenath, so a churn review is set for July 15.

### Reset Flow v2 (Hollowmere Accounts)

New flow: single-use emailed code, short expiry, no security questions. Support can resend codes but cannot read them. Lockout after repeated bad attempts; users must wait out the cooldown, no manual override. Expect tickets about expired codes during rollout. Timing and attempt limits are defined by the following constants.

tuning table, faduf-baduf:
PRIORITIES = {
    "ulavan": 191,
    "silys": 750,
    "goriel": 238,
    "kelmir": 66,
    "wendor": 432,
}